Today, students who want to learn English in the US have a wide choice of courses and institutions to(26)choose from. And, because the US is such a big country, they also have a huge(27)variety of locations in which to study. The US has a long(28)tradition of teaching English because,(29)throughout its history, the country has welcomed immigrants from(30)all over the world, most of who have needed to learn English. Today, the US English language teaching sector is well developed and its teachers are highly qualified and(31)experienced. American universities and colleges welcome many(32)thousands of overseas students each year, who(33)enroll on degree or post graduate courses. Most of these institutions provide preparation courses for students who need to improve their English before they start university study. These courses are called Intensive English Language Programmes and they are the most(34)common type of courses taken by overseas students.(35)In addition to language tuition, Intensive English Language Programmes give students the chance to get to know the school where they will be studying and become more familiar with the American academic environment.
